Output 3bd53be6c7253668c0cd5f2a2d97e9058900fdc1ba71871b3fa323eb22e5c67e:1

value
577304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a86c20e0c44b058cbcee716e3a626a2b8567bd17 OP_EQUAL
address
3H3YyfbaTbFcyMcjYATTo9opoGBRjCxs5y
transaction
3bd53be6c7253668c0cd5f2a2d97e9058900fdc1ba71871b3fa323eb22e5c67e
spent
true